What is EHS Management Software?
EHS management software is a digital solution that helps organizations manage their environmental, health, and safety responsibilities more efficiently. These software tools are designed to streamline processes, track and report on key metrics, and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ements. By centralizing data and automating tasks, EHS management software can help organizations save time and resources while improving overall EHS performance.

Key Features of Advanced EHS Management Software
When choosing an EHS management software solution, it's essential to look for key features that can help you streamline compliance and improve EHS performance. Some of the features to consider include:
Incident Management: Track and report on workplace incidents in real-time, enabling quick response and analysis to prevent future occurrences.
Risk Assessment: Identify and assess potential risks to employee health and safety, as well as environmental impact, to proactively mitigate hazards.
Compliance Monitoring: Stay up-to-date on changing regulations and standards, ensuring your organization remains in compliance at all times.
Auditing: Conduct internal and external audits with ease, collecting and analyzing data to identify areas for improvement.
Training Management: Ensure all employees are properly trained on EHS procedures and protocols, reducing the risk of accidents and non-compliance.
